Understanding Auditory Handling
When it pertains to comprehending acoustic handling, you may be surprised by how important it's for analysis and language development. Acoustic handling describes just how your brain translates and makes sense of noises you hear, including speech. This ability is crucial for recognizing phonemes, which are the foundation of words.
If you fight with acoustic handling, you may find it challenging to decode words, leading to problems in reading. You could see that people with dyslexia frequently have trouble with auditory handling, making it harder for them to link audios with letters. This disconnect can cause sluggish reading, poor spelling, and challenges in following verbal instructions.
Identifying these signs early can assist you recognize the underlying problems and address them effectively.

Evidence-Based Interventions
Effective evidence-based interventions can substantially improve auditory processing skills in individuals with dyslexia. One tried and tested method is phonological recognition training. This strategy aids you establish the ability to acknowledge and control noises in talked language, which is essential for reading and writing. Programs frequently include tasks like rhyming, segmenting, and blending noises, making it interactive and appealing.
One more efficient treatment is using multisensory mentor methods. Incorporating visual, acoustic, and kinesthetic signs can strengthen understanding. For instance, using colored letters or blocks while stating audios aloud can produce stronger connections in your brain.
Furthermore, computer-assisted treatments like auditory training software application can provide tailored technique. These programs frequently adapt to your details requirements, giving targeted exercises that enhance auditory discrimination and memory.
Last but not least, integrating songs and rhythm right into learning can likewise support auditory processing. Study reveals that music training can boost brain functions connected to appear processing, assisting you become extra adept at distinguishing audios in speech.
